It’s spooky season in the Snap-verse, and Jesse and Evan are back on the Snap Material Podcast to celebrate three years of Marvel Snap with a deep dive into last season: Undead Horde! This jam-packed episode breaks down every creepy card, examines the rise (and occasional stumble) of zombie-themed decks, and delivers thoughtful insights on which new strategies are actually worth your energy cubes.
From the mechanics of the new Horde card and the synergy around Zombie Scarlet Witch and Merlin, to the quirky utility of Headpool and the hit-or-miss experience with Zombie Galacti, the hosts unpack what worked, what didn’t, and how the evolving meta shaped their builds. Evan shares his experiments with destruction decks powered by cards like Moira X and Killmonger, while Jesse reveals how Zombie Captain Marvel became his go-to playmaker—even if Infinite rank stayed just out of reach.
Also on the table: surprising thoughts on cards like Colonel America, Zombie Mr. Fantastic, and Zombie Giant-Man. The hosts even spotlight how limited support early in the season created challenges for Horde synergy, and whether the undead archetype has staying power or is destined to rot until next October.
